Dom’s Pizza Company uses taste testing and statistical analysis of the data prior to marketing any new product. Consider a study involving three types of crusts (thin, thin with garlic and oregano, and thin with bits of cheese). Dom’s is also studying three sauces (standard, a new sauce with more garlic, and a new sauce with fresh basil). (a) How many combinations of crust and sauce are involved? (b) What is the probability that a judge will get a plain thin crust with a standard sauce for his first taste test?

a) As there are total six atimes so there combination will be 3*3=9 b) there is only one chance for judge to get Plain thin crust with standard sauce so P(B)=1/9
